Description

The Banking Associate at a TD Bank store location is responsible for accurately processing daily banking transactions and offering advice and educational support on various services, products, and tools to help customers achieve their financial objectives. This role focuses on building customer trust, providing consultative support, and proactive recommendations.

What We're Looking For

Perform a wide range of tasks including customer transactions, opening new accounts, and educating customers on banking products and services.,Deliver end-to-end advice by building trust with educational content, providing consultative support, and offering proactive insights.,Utilize TD's systems to engage with customers, acquire, and deepen relationships.,Understand customer financial needs to identify opportunities for promotion or referral to appropriate team members.,Accurately complete everyday banking transactions on both teller line and platform.,Service customers by opening/closing personal deposit accounts, handling debit/credit card issues, regulation E, and digital banking.,Connect with customers, provide financial advice, and deepen relationships through lead management activities, outbound calls, and appointments.,Consistently provide legendary customer service.,Establish and nurture customer relationships by displaying product knowledge and actively listening to needs.,Manage wait times and engage in lobby leadership as a first point of contact for inquiries and resolutions.,Understand and support the Bank's customer service strategy.,Drive referrals to store colleagues and partners.,Ensure tasks are performed within established policy and procedures.,Complete all required job-specific and compliance-related training.,Understand and follow compliance/risk and control programs.,Ensure ongoing compliance with internal/external audit and regulatory requirements.,Ensure compliance with operational activities and regulations like Bank Secrecy Act and Patriot Act.,Accurately process cash/deposit/withdrawal transactions.,Apply customer authentication principles and due diligence for new account openings and transactions.,Maintain cash drawers, limits, and secure stations.,Act as Dual Control agent when required.,Follow all required open/close procedures.,Contribute to a positive work environment and align with TD Model, Brand and Culture.,Be an active participant in personal performance and development.,Collaborate with team members and partner as a team player.,Actively seek opportunities to improve work delivery with high attention to quality standards.,Take ownership of career and aspirations, seeking diverse feedback.,Positively embrace change.,Adhere and participate in TD's Shared Commitments.,Model quality service at every customer interaction.,Be engaged in advancing and sustaining an inclusive culture.

About the Company

T

The Toronto-Dominion Bank

The Toronto-Dominion Bank and its subsidiaries are collectively known as TD Bank Group, one of the largest banks in North America. TD provides a wide range of personal, commercial, and investment banking products and services to over 27 million customers globally. Headquartered in Toronto, Canada, the bank operates through key segments including Canadian Retail, U.S. Retail, and Wholesale Banking.
